Self-locking nozzle blocks for steam turbines
Patent
·
OSTI ID:5669042
This patent describes an axial flow steam turbine. It comprises a rotor; a casing; an inlet nozzle ring disposed circumferentially about the rotor within the casing, having a first thermal coefficient of expansion, the inlet nozzle ring including radially spaced inner and outer shrouds; nozzle blocks, having a second thermal coefficient of expansion greater than the first coefficient of expansion of the inlet nozzle ring, and having radially inwardly and outwardly extending flanges; apertures formed through the front arcuate section of the nozzle ring; coaxial bores formed in the rear arcuate section thereof to form an end wall; and a locking pin, having a thermal coefficient of expansion greater than the first coefficient of expansion of the inlet nozzle ring, inserted into the bore in the rear arcuate section having a first end contacting the end wall, and a second end flush with the face of the rear arcuate section at ambient temperature.
